One urine test that has come into popular use is the EtG (ethyl glucuronide) test, which can determine recent alcohol consumption even if no measurable alcohol is present in the system. Because actual partition ratios vary person-to-person and for the same person over time, defense attorneys often challenged the accuracy of this breath-to-blood conversion.
